Indian Vocational Training United Tribes Technical College

Program Information

Popular name

N/A

Program Number

15.060

Program objective

To provide vocational training to individual American Indians through the United Tribes Technical College, located in Bismarck, North Dakota.

25 CFR 26 and 25 CFR 27. For awards to United Tribes Technical College see also 25 CFR Part 900.

  1. Snyder Act of 1921, Public Law 67-85, 42 Stat. 208, 25 U.S.C. 13; Indian Adult Vocational Training Act of 1956, Public Law 84-959, 70 Stat. 986, as amended; Public Law 88-230, 77 Stat. 471, 25 U.S.C. 309; Indian Self-Determination and Education Assistance Act, Public Law 93-638, as amended, 25 U.S.C. 450.
